The Role of Ads in Free Gaming
Most free games use ads to earn money. While some players find ads annoying, many understand them as a fair price for free play. Creators now work on minimizing ad time or offer bonuses for ad views. This keeps the game flow less interrupted. As long as ads don’t interrupt gameplay too much, players are fine with seeing them in exchange for cost-free entertainment.
